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$887 per month in Semenyih vs $1,392 in Ubud, Bali, rent included.

A couple spends around $1,337 per month in Semenyih vs $2,557 in Ubud, Bali, rent included.

A family of three spends $1,787 per month in Semenyih vs $3,723 in Ubud, Bali, rent included.

Semenyih is about 36% cheaper than Ubud, Bali, driven mainly by Sport & Entertainment.

Semenyih sits 33% below the global median, while Ubud, Bali is 5% above – they fall on opposite sides of the world average.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$393 in Semenyih versus $1,020 in Ubud, Bali.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 312% higher in Semenyih, which reinforces the cost advantage – you earn more and spend less. Purchasing power leans clearly in its favor.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$19.00 in Semenyih versus $32.00 in Ubud, Bali.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$259 vs $298 – making Semenyih the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
